Output 316d9940bbd46990c92af8108e9d0eb89f7471431b748a8f00370ec366bb2255:2

value
1982572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e06e5a640537ac08f088965c38015d289918c1 OP_EQUAL
address
3MBti9WY7ZvqjbpPXrfHSvyQsPdNEvunhn
transaction
316d9940bbd46990c92af8108e9d0eb89f7471431b748a8f00370ec366bb2255
spent
true